Rows Farmhouse is situated in a fantastic rural location, conveniently positioned less than a mile from Bampton and just 7 miles from Tiverton.
The historic village of Bampton offers a good range of local amenities including some lovely independent shops, two convenience stores, pubs, primary school and doctors surgery with chemist. The much larger market town of Tiverton lies 7 miles to the south with extensive local facilities including supermarkets, hospital, leisure centre, golf course and the renowned Blundell's School. From Tiverton there is easy access to communication links including the A361 North Devon link road, M5 motorway and Tiverton Parkway railway station providing regular services to London Paddington in two hours. The whole area is well known for its outstanding natural beauty with Exmoor National Park just a few miles to the north and the beaches of the beautiful North Devon coast are only a 45 minute drive.
Nestled in an elevated position above the charming village of Bampton, Rows Farm enjoys breathtaking, panoramic views stretching across the picturesque Exe Valley. With the original part of the house dating back to the 1700s, this remarkable period farmhouse is brimming with character and history, yet it is not listed—offering greater flexibility for those looking to modernise or extend.
The property boasts nearly 3,000 sq ft of accommodation, including five generously proportioned bedrooms, three of which benefit from an en-suite.
